The Oyo State Deputy Governor, Engr. Rauf Olaniyan has debunked Oyo State Government’s position that he was part of the Oke-Ogun stakeholders that wanted Police Squadron to be sited in Igboho instead Ago-Are in Oke-Ogun.

Special Adviser on Political Matters to Governor Seyi Makinde, Hon. Babatunde Oduyoye while featuring on a popular socio-political programme on Fresh FM Ibadan “Political Circuit” on Saturday, said that some bigwigs in Oke-Ogun requested that the Police Squadron be situated in Igboho town.

In a swift reaction to the revelation made by Hon. Babs Oduyoye, the anchor of the programme, Mr. Mayor Isaac Brown, read out a reaction message sent to his phone by the Deputy Governor. According to Mayor, “I (Deputy Governor)was not one of the political office holders from Oke-ogun who requested that the Squadron should be located in Igboho”.

Immediately after the message was read out, Hon. Oduyoye countered Engr. Olaniyan message again saying, ”It was not to be sited in Igboho, the Deputy Governor had inputs. His domain covers the whole of Okeogun; he is the Deputy Governor and he is the highest-ranking political officer of the Peoples Democratic Party from Okeogun.

Hon. Oduyoye further said that Governor Makinde went to Abuja August to request for the Police Mobile Squadron to strengthen the security of the state as against the general view that it was diverted from Oyo town to Ago-Are.
